FRANCIS BACON (1909-1992)
Studies of the human Body
offset lithograph in colours, 1980, on wove paper, signed in felt-tip pen, inscribed AP, an artist's proof aside from the edition of 250, the colours, signature and numbering faded, framed; together with two exhibition posters, Francis Bacon Retrospective Exhibition Poster, Central House of the Union of Artists, Moscow, 22 September to 7 November 1988, dedicated To Roy Geordie, Best wishes, John; and Second Version of Painting 1946, poster for Städtische Kunsthalle, Düsseldorf, 1971, both framed
Sheet 1012 x 660 mm. (Studies)
(3)
